Georgian filmmakers cut off from the world by an avalanche in Svaneti

A Georgian crew of 30 cinematographers has been cut off from the outside world in the Svaneti village of Ushguli due to an avalanche that descended 10 days ago.

"We have run out of products and medical supplies, almost the entire group of 30 people have fallen ill with the flu virus, we are in serious condition," Interfax quotes the director Levan Kuhashvili as saying.

He noted that 10 days ago an avalanche descended on the road, which was reported to the local authorities, but until now the village has been cut off from the outside world.
